Rectal mesh erosion after robotic sacrocolpopexy

Summary
A rare complication of robotic sacrocolpopexy, rectal mesh erosion, occurred 16 months post-surgery. This case highlights a delayed presentation of mesh erosion after pelvic reconstructive surgery.

Observation:
- A patient presented with hematochezia 16 months after undergoing robotic sacrocolpopexy, lysis of adhesions, midurethral sling, and posterior colporrhaphy.
- The patient had an initially uneventful postoperative recovery from the initial surgery.
- A 2x2 cm anterior rectal mesh erosion was identified during colonoscopy.
Findings:
- Rectal mesh erosion is an uncommon but serious complication following robotic sacrocolpopexy.
- Delayed presentation of mesh erosion, up to 16 months post-surgery, is possible.
- Hematochezia can be a presenting symptom of rectal mesh erosion.
Implications:
- This case underscores the importance of vigilance for delayed mesh complications after pelvic reconstructive surgery.
- Further research may be needed to elucidate risk factors and optimal management strategies for rectal mesh erosion.
- Enhanced patient counseling regarding potential long-term mesh-related complications is warranted.
